The Ultimate Hong Kong Sports Calendar
Hong Kong weather swings from humid summers to cool, dry winters. Choosing the right activity for each season keeps children safe and enthusiastic all year.
Spring: March to May
Mild temperatures make outdoor pitches perfect for football and rugby. Book tennis courts early before humidity rises, and apply sunscreen even on cloudy days.
Summer: June to August
High heat and frequent showers push play indoors. Our air‑conditioned basketball and gymnastics halls keep kids comfortable. Morning classes are best for those who still want to train outdoors.
Autumn: September to November
Clear skies and gentle breezes mark the best months for athletics meets and introductory trail runs. Keep an eye on typhoon alerts; the Total Sports App notifies families immediately about schedule changes.
Winter: December to February
Chilly but dry days are ideal for endurance sports and technical tennis drills. Holiday camps during school breaks provide multi‑hour sessions that mix skill work and social play.
